2nd Attempt to Stop Drinking

Hi all,
I was able to stop for 6 weeks prior to last Christmas but unfortunately the holiday season took hold and I fell back into my old routines. After a couple of nasty exchanges with my family after too many drinks recently, I'm motivated again to try to quit drinking for good. I don't want to turn into my alcoholic Mom who was a mean drunk for years. Hope this forum will help! 3rd day and counting.....

I drank a lot of nice herbal teas and flavoured seltzer waters instead of alcohol and did reward myself sometimes with a nice dessert :-) When I had anxiety attacks (usually between the hours of 4-8pm when I'd usually start drinking), I'd walk the dogs and try to divert my thoughts with a good book or hobby.
